All Movies List
Sorry if I Love You

as Erica

2008
Francesca Ferrazzo Francesca Ferrazzo

Birthday

1989-11-29

Place of Birth

Rome, Italy

Biography

AD

WATCH FREE FOR 30 DAYS

All Prime Video
Cancel anytime
Watch Now